Looking for Divorce Lawyers in Poughkeepsie?

Divorce lawyers specialize in the legal dissolution of a marriage. They guide clients through the complexities of dividing assets and debts, determining spousal support (alimony), and resolving disputes through negotiation, mediation, or litigation when necessary. These attorneys advocate for their clients’ financial interests to achieve a fair and equitable settlement or court order.

In New York State what is the potential marital asset value of a spouse who has become a RN during the marriage and previously worked minimally.

Kristen Prata Browde
Answered by attorney Kristen Prata Browde (Unclaimed Profile)
Divorce lawyer at Browde Law, P.C.
The question isn't the value of the RN, but the enhanced earnings capacity it generates. To calculate one looks at what the individual was doing before becoming an RN, what the salary was, and compares it to the earnings as an RN. A professional evaluation is usually necessary if this is to be a litigated point.

Do my soon to be ex wife have rights to my bachelor accounting degree?

Kristen Prata Browde
Answered by attorney Kristen Prata Browde (Unclaimed Profile)
Divorce lawyer at Browde Law, P.C.
That's a timing question. Did you earn your degree during the marriage? If so she may have a claim to a portion of the enhanced earnings that flow from the degree.

Can I claim ligal seperation if my wife is not sleeping at home more then 5 days

Answered by attorney Seth David Schraier
Divorce lawyer at Law Office of Seth D. Schraier, P.C.
New York State has an "abandonment" grounds to file for divorce, which may be what you are thinking of.  "Actual abandonment consists of the unjustified leaving of the marital home by one of the parties. If one of the parties leaves the marital home with the consent of the other party, there is no abandonment. Another form of abandonment is constructive abandonment, which is the unjustified refusal to engage in sexual relations with the other party. Again, if both parties consent to not engage in sexual relations, there is no constructive abandonment by either party. At the time of the commencement of the action, the abandonment must be one full year."   One thing to take note of, however, is that the abandonment requires that it continue for at least a year or more.  So five days of her not sleeping at home would not fall under those grounds. However, since New York State now allows a "no fault" divorce, you no longer need to satisfy any waiting period to file as long as you satisfy the jurisdictional requirements.  In fact, since the grounds for divorce have very little to no relation to equitable distribution or other matters related to the divorce, there is no reason to file for divorce under any other grounds except No Fault.
